About Indianapolis

Indianapolis, the capital of Indiana and the most populous city in the state, is a vibrant and exciting city. There's plenty to do here, from exploring its many historical landmarks to attending events at one of its many theaters. In Indianapolis, theatergoers can experience all forms of theatrical performance - from movies to Broadway-style musicals.

The historic Old National Centre is great for music lovers, with its world-class acoustics and classic theater atmosphere. It hosts several music concerts throughout the year, as well as special comedy shows. Other notable theatres serve up delicious meals along with traditional Broadway favorites.

For film lovers, downtown Indianapolis boasts numerous cinemas and smaller independent theaters that show international films or Indy Film Fest showcasing local up-and-coming filmmakers' works. This fantastic variety ensures that no matter what kind of experience you're looking for in theater – Indianapolis has something to offer everyone!

Tips on How to Organize Theater Spaces in Indianapolis

Indy's theater community is booming, which means more opportunities are available for theater lovers to enjoy shows in various spaces around the city. However, knowing how to organize your theater space when starting can also be a bit challenging. Here are a few tips to help you get started:

  • Start by measuring the width and length of your stage: This will give you an idea of how much space you have to work with and what kind of layout will best suit your needs.

  • Decide what kind of seating you want: Will you have fixed rows of seats, or will you allow audiences to move around? How many seats do you want in each row?

  • Consider your backstage area: You'll need a holding area, changing rooms, and space for costumes, props, and set pieces. Make sure there's plenty of room for actors to move around and get into character before they go on stage.

  • Think about lighting and sound: It is crucial that the audience see and hear the action on stage. Pay attention to the placement of the light and how you can best amplify the sound of voices and music.

  • Don't forget about access for people with disabilities: Make sure there's an accessible entrance and exit that provides a clear path for wheelchair users.

Famous Locations in Indianapolis

  • Indiana Theatre
    The Indiana Theatre is a magnificent performance space from the Roaring Twenties which features an intricate architectural design. It is six stories tall, made of concrete, and encased in white terra cotta. The original marquee still hangs over the entrance of the Theatre, which was constructed in 1922. At the front, a curved triangular arch adorned with ornamental framing greets visitors.

  • Phoenix Theatre
    For over 39 years, the Phoenix Theatre has been a popular performance venue in Indianapolis. It is recognized for its cutting-edge and one-of-a-kind performances that challenge the intellect, touch the heart and inspire the human spirit. A nonprofit organization that brings world premiere productions from Broadway and Off-Broadway shows to Indiana and the Midwest; the venue has also hosted 94 World Premieres.
